Givaudan SA – ADR (OTCMKT:GVDNY) Seasonal Chart
Seasonal Chart Analysis
Analysis of the Givaudan SA – ADR (OTCMKT:GVDNY) seasonal charts above shows that a Buy Date of March 8 and a Sell Date of August 1 has resulted in a geometric average return of 5.84% above the benchmark rate of the S&P 500 Total Return Index over the past 15 years. This seasonal timeframe has shown positive results compared to the benchmark in 14 of those periods. This is an excellent rate of success and the return strongly outperforms the relative buy-and-hold performance of the stock over the past 15 years by an average of 4.84% per year.
The seasonal timeframe correlates Poorly with the period of seasonal strength for the Materials sector, which runs from November 20 to May 5. The seasonal chart for the broad sector is available via the following link: Materials Sector Seasonal Chart.
Givaudan SA engages in the manufacture and distribution of fragrance and flavour products. It operates through the Fragrance & Beauty and Taste & Wellbeing segments. The Fragrance and Beauty segment is involved in the manufacture and sale of fragrance and beauty products into three global business units: Fine Fragrances, Consumer Products, and Fragrance Ingredients and Active Beauty. The Taste and Wellbeing segment manufactures and sells taste and wellbeing products into five business units: Beverages, Dairy, Savoury, Sweet Goods, and Natural Ingredients. The company was founded by Leon Givaudan and Xavier Givaudan in 1895 and is headquartered in Vernier, Switzerland.
